Ticket: Staging env misconfigured for Siftgate bloom filter

The bloom layer in front of the Pellet KV store is rejecting all lookups in staging because the env file was copied from the dev template without credentials. False-positive tuning values are fine; only the auth line is missing. To unblock the weekly demo, the Pellet admission secret must be set on the following line.

env line for yaguf-fajop: LEDGER_TOKEN13=fb08984397349

Handover note — Crumbwheel order cutoffs.

Welcome aboard. The bakery cutoff rule in Crumbwheel closes same-day orders at 14:00 local to each storefront, not UTC — this has bitten us twice. Holiday overrides live in the calendar service and take precedence silently, so always check there first when a cutoff looks wrong. To unlock the calendar service's admin console after a restart, enter the recovery passphrase below.

vault phrase of bagap-bahaf = silion-pelox-sorox-casdor-quenwyn-fraax-eliox-praael-kelion-quenvan-kasox-rusael-norius-belvan

**Ticket: Drift in Larkspur build config**

The Larkspur pipeline still pulls toolchains from machine-local caches, which breaks our hermetic build migration. Three agents now disagree on compiler versions. New folks: do not hand-edit agent configs; everything must come from the pinned manifest. To reproduce the clean state, wipe the agent and apply the values below.

service settings:
PRAWYN_PIN=9848
PRAWYN_METRICS_HOST=metrics.prawyn.lumicworks.corp
PRAWYN_LOG_LEVEL=warn
PRAWYN_TENANT=pelius